JBL Synthesis and Mark Levinson brands combine to make one impressive home theater system.
When you think about home theater in a box setups, you probably think about those $500 sets that so many people pick up. The Synthesis is in a very different price range.
The home theater system from Harman brands JBL and Mark Levinson is stocked with everything you need to make an insanely cool home theater. On the electronics side, you get a surround sound processor, two multichannel amps, two stereo amps, an equalizer and an interconnect kit to wire it all together.
You also get enough loudspeakers to outfit even the most demanding home theater. You'll get three high-frequency horn modules, three low frequency woofer modules, four multipolar in-wall surrounds and a pair of passive 18 inch subs.
It's not cheap, coming in at $88,100.
